Roof Damage Inspection Services
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roof to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. Professionals typically examine the roofing materials, flashing, gutters, and overall structure to detect signs of wear, leaks, or deterioration. This process may include visual inspections and, in some cases, the use of specialized tools or equipment to assess areas that are difficult to see from the ground.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ear understanding of their roof’s condition and to pinpoint any areas that require repair or maintenance.
These inspections help address common problems such as leaks, missing or damaged shingles, and structural weaknesses that can lead to more serious issues if left unaddressed. Early detection of damage can prevent costly repairs and extend the lifespan of the roof. Inspections are especially valuable after severe weather events, such as storms or heavy winds, which can cause immediate damage or weaken roofing components over time. Regular inspections also assist in identifying minor issues before they develop into significant problems, contributing to better property preservation.

The overview below groups typical Roof Damage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Torrance,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Inspection Fees - The cost for roof damage inspections typically 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Some providers may charge a flat fee or hourly rate within this range.
Additional Testing - If further testing or detailed assessments are needed, costs can increase to $300-$700. This may include moisture scans or structural evaluations to identify hidden damage.
Travel and Accessibility - Fees may vary based on the location and accessibility of the roof. Remote or hard-to-reach roofs could incur extra charges, often between $50 and $200.
Inspection Packages - Some service providers offer bundled inspection packages for around $200-$600, which may include multiple assessments or follow-up inspections for comprehensive evaluation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of roof damage to look for? Common indicators include missing or damaged shingles, water stains on ceilings, and visible sagging or curling roof edges.
How can a roof damage inspection benefit homeowners? An inspection can identify issues early, helping to prevent costly repairs and maintain the integrity of the roof.
What methods do professionals use during a roof inspection? Inspectors typically examine the roof surface, check for leaks or water damage, and assess the condition of shingles and flashing.
How often should a roof be inspected for damage? It is recommended to have a roof inspected after severe weather events and at least once a year for regular maintenance.
